This is an automated email from the ASF dual-hosted git repository.
yasith pushed a change to branch feat/thrift-server-extraction
in repository https://gitbox.apache.org/repos/asf/airavata.git
at 6b56687d1d chore: final cleanup after thrift server extraction
This branch includes the following new commits:
new bfb4695cc3 docs: add airavata-thrift-server extraction design spec
new af40880f3c docs: add airavata-thrift-server extraction implementation
plan
new f3fb870a1a feat: add airavata-thrift-server Maven module scaffold
new f897bf5b05 refactor: move thrift IDL to
airavata-thrift-server/src/main/thrift
new 71bf553785 refactor: move AiravataServer and Constants to
airavata-thrift-server
new 22746c5eac refactor: move AiravataServerHandler and ThriftAdapter to
airavata-thrift-server
new 7f58033464 refactor: move profile handlers and
OrchestratorServerHandler to airavata-thrift-server
new e98b569f96 feat: add proto definitions mirroring all thrift IDL data
models
new a4500a7cae build: add protobuf-java dependency and protoc compilation
to airavata-api
new 30c7f5c4b5 build: add MapStruct dependency to airavata-thrift-server
new 2ab97d8c0d fix: rename proto fields to avoid Protobuf 4.x Java codegen
name collision
new 588de0a192 feat: add representative MapStruct mapper for workspace
types
new 6b56687d1d chore: final cleanup after thrift server extraction
The 13 revisions listed above as "new" are entirely new to this
repository and will be described in separate emails. The revisions
listed as "add" were already present in the repository and have only
been added to this reference.